About the role

  • Project Manager leading contaminated sites programs at the Department of Conservation. Ensuring project delivery, stakeholder engagement and budget management across New Zealand.

Responsibilities

  • Project delivery; be accountable for the delivery of a portfolio of contaminated sites projects across a range of stages including investigation, remediation planning and remediation in accordance with DOC’s Project Management Framework.
  • Contract Management; be responsible for procuring required consultancy and construction services follow all government and DOC procurement guidelines;
  • Financial management; manage the project allocated budgets including raising and managing purchase orders and undertaking routing reporting and forecasting.
  • Health, Safety and Wellbeing; be responsible for ensuring work is delivered safely, is regularly audited and appropriately tracked through DOC’s internal Health and Safety monitoring software.
  • Collaboration; support the Programme Manager to deliver the wider national programme by delivering to scope, time, and budget.
  • Stakeholder Engagement; Work closely with Treaty partners, operational teams, technical specialists, and contractors to make sure solutions meet frontline needs.
  • Planning & Execution; Support the maintaining of project plans, reporting and risk registers, validation of payment claims, monitor on site progress, manage risks and dependencies, and resolve issues proactively

Requirements

  • Proven experience overseeing contractors and consultants particularly in relation to civil construction works.
  • Managing compliance, auditing of quality, health and safety and delivery to designs/specifications.
  • Excellent stakeholder management and communication skills
  • Familiarity with Agile and/or Waterfall methodologies
  • Ability to manage budgets, risks, and resources effectively
  • Experience in conservation, public sector, or operational environments (preferred)
  • Experience in management of contaminated sites or delivery projects in a contaminated sites setting.
  • Qualifications in project management, engineering, or related fields or demonstrated equivalent experience in project delivery roles.
  • Project management certifications (PMP, PRINCE2, AgilePM) (Desirable)
